ICMP网络掩码请求响应漏洞解析与防护措施
在互联网通信中,ICMP(Internet Control Message Protocol)是一种用于在网络层进行错误报告和控制信息传输的协议,它主要用于提供网络状态报告、路由更新以及错误通知等,在实际应用中,ICMP也存在一些潜在的安全风险,其中最引人关注的是“ICMP网络掩码请求响应漏洞”。
什么是ICMP网络掩码请求响应漏洞?
ICMP网络掩码请求响应漏洞是指攻击者利用ICMP消息中的IP地址和子网掩码字段来获取目标主机的网络配置信息,通过发送特定的ICMP请求报文,并监听接收端口的状态变化,攻击者可以获取到目标系统的网络参数,如IP地址、子网掩码、默认网关等敏感信息。
漏洞产生的原因及影响
- 网络配置信息泄露:ICMP消息能够携带丰富的网络信息,包括但不限于网络拓扑结构、系统属性等,一旦被攻击者捕获,便可能为恶意行为埋下伏笔。
- 安全风险高:在网络环境中,特别是涉及身份验证或访问控制的应用场景下,网络配置信息的泄露可能导致未经授权的用户获取系统权限,甚至发起进一步的攻击。
如何防范ICMP网络掩码请求响应漏洞
-
增强安全性策略:
- 设置严格的ICMP防火墙规则:限制ICMP流量进入和流出的端口范围。
- 启用ICMP保护:在操作系统层面开启ICMP保护功能,以减少未授权ICMP报文的生成。
-
定期审计和监控:
- 实施ICMP流量分析:使用网络安全工具对ICMP流量进行实时监测,及时发现异常行为。
- 定期备份和恢复策略:确保在网络配置发生变化时,有相应的备份机制,以便快速恢复至正常状态。
-
教育与培训:
- 提高员工意识:加强员工对ICMP安全威胁的认识,避免无意间触发ICMP相关事件。
- 定期培训:组织定期的安全培训课程,提升团队成员对ICMP防护的了解和能力。
-
采用先进的ICMP处理技术:
- 基于角色的访问控制:根据员工的角色和职责,限制其对ICMP数据包的访问权限。
- 动态ICMP过滤器:利用软件工具动态过滤不符合安全策略的ICMP报文,有效防止非法ICMP报文的影响。
ICMP网络掩码请求响应漏洞虽然在一定程度上提供了对网络环境深入了解的机会,但同时也带来了严重的安全风险,通过采取上述措施,可以在很大程度上降低该漏洞带来的负面影响,保障网络环境的安全稳定运行,随着技术和手段的进步,针对ICMP网络掩码请求响应漏洞的研究也将不断深入,以应对新的安全挑战。